At Sue Ryder our aim is to transform the experience of everyone facing dying and grief in the UK. We want to help build a society that enables people from all communities to access the care and support that they need.

We are currently recruiting for a Head of Wellbeing and Community Support Services to be based at Sue Ryder St john's Hospice in Moggerhanger, Bedford

The Head Wellbeing and Community Support Service will lead a team who are responsible for helping us to provide more of the support that people need, in more accessible ways, to more communities The Wellbeing and Community Support Service team will be responsible for:

• Increasing the reach of hospice support, through improved local community collaboration and co-production
• Deliver a range of holistic support which is aligned to the specific needs of the individuals.
• Implement local and national initiatives which support the wellbeing of staff and volunteers
• Increase Sue Ryder’s wellbeing community based services

About the role

Working closely with the Service Director as a member of the Senior Management Team, the Head of Wellbeing and Community Support Service will lead and promote the Wellbeing and Holistic support of our staff, volunteers, service users and those close to them, as well as leading local community engagement initiatives and innovations supporting national agenda.

Through their oversight of community engagement, support for service users and families, volunteering and staff and volunteer wellbeing, they will provide strategic oversight of support provided to ensure we build links with local communities to shape services and ways of working that meet the changing needs of those we are supporting in the local community.

Through their experience in either counselling, palliative social work or psychiatry, they will also work with the local MDT to help provide guidance and advice when reviewing patient cases and referrals. They will also be available to provide support with individual crisis or complex patient management where their skills can be used for short term interventions or to identify the most appropriate support for the individual and their families where needed.

About you

You should be an accredited counsellor, social worker or psychiatry professional with experience of working in a healthcare, social care or public health related discipline, working across a multi-disciplinary team.

Additionally, you will need to demonstrate

• Significant experience working at a Senior Management level in a healthcare/social care environment to include a proven track record in the strategic development of new services.
• Experience of scoping gaps in services in local areas and developing and managing support services in a community setting to fill these gaps.
• Evidence of setting SMART outcomes and measuring impact against those outcomes
• Demonstrable experience delivering supervision for staff and volunteers outside of normal line management.
• Experience of working with a range of diverse communities, developing long term community relationships with local healthcare providers and influential members of the local community.
• Knowledge and experience of safeguarding
• Experience of managing teams and budgets to include volunteering services
